Transaction 26018d2563868541e6bfc56ba8ebc0bf1511340a2caa5ec131b6d1d5db4ed74d
1 Input
1 Output
-
26018d2563868541e6bfc56ba8ebc0bf1511340a2caa5ec131b6d1d5db4ed74d:0
- value
- 91489
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ddf00ee2611fd1284e2724a912c6af1418a9809e OP_EQUAL
- address
- 3MvWqUEcEX7hbGG4XCBhB1wrNB5a71sUkJ